Barriseal-S and Barricoat-S spray-applied vapor and water-resistant membranes are rubberized asphalt emulsions that require simultaneous spray with a salt solution to cure. This chemistry provides a system with fast application, low equipment and material costs, low VOCs, and fast curing over a broad temperature range. Carlisle offers a co-spray that is chloride-free, permitting application of barriers where the use of chlorides is forbidden.
